Abstract

Terdapat beberapa cara yang digunakan oleh sebuah perusahaan / toko untuk mengembangkan bisnisnya. Salah satu yang dapat dilakukan adalah dengan membuka cabang baru ditempat lain. Pemilihan daerah yang akan dijadikan cabang baru juga tidak dapat dipilih secara sembarangan. Terdapat kriteria-kriteria yang dapat meningkatkan laba perusahaan, dalam hal ini UD Indo Multi Fish. Dengan menggunakan metode Simple Additive Weighting (SAW) dapat memberikan rekomendasi daerah mana yang sesuai untuk dijadikan cabang baru toko tersebut. Nilai dengan ranking tertinggi merupakan daerah yang dapat rekomendasikan untuk dibuka cabang baru.

Abstract

It is the mission of Vocational High School (SMK) education in Indonesia to produce highly competitive and skilled graduates. One standard for evaluating the success of vocational education is assessing the achievements of alumni. The evaluation process can be carried out with programmed alumni tracking activities or commonly known as tracer studies. However, the implementations of tracer studies that have been carried out by vocational schools in Kediri are still using the manual method. These conditions make the school find many obstacles in the implementation of tracer studies. Some schools have used technology with e-mail applications but have financial constraints. This research aims to improve the performance of assessing the alumni achievement of Vocational Schools in Kediri by integrating the website-based tracer study information system with social media Telegram API. Usability testing that gave 4.83 of 5 scales has shown that the integration can improve the performance and benefits of an application compared to the application before integration

Abstract

The career path of an employee does not necessarily immediately become a permanent employee of a company. Employees must go through the stages of contract employees and then undergo a series of tests to be appointed as permanent employees. The determination of contract employees to become permanent employees in PT BAV through a series of tests that require a long time. The assessments and calculations are carried out in stages such as file selection, written tests, psychological tests, interviews, and so on. With a long series of tests it is possible to make mistakes in the final results and the candidates do not getthe criteria required by the company so as to hamper the company's performance. In this study the TOPSIS method is applied to determine the best candidates who can be appointed by the company to become permanent employees.
